Output ff5b366c511beba2da16df7e0a142f5e1be50a130058dacedaedeb54a2de25c4:2

value
11017456
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f838942648d52972869384d9bf1fe3de807c8eca OP_EQUAL
address
3QKVHGvTgnTbsEhiHobCW1FzuiEJN1xJ3a
transaction
ff5b366c511beba2da16df7e0a142f5e1be50a130058dacedaedeb54a2de25c4
confirmations
434332
spent
true